Liverpool star Hugo Ekitike has made a flying start to life on Merseyside but he’s named one Premier League striker who he wants to ‘be like’ when it comes to his finishing under Arne Slot.Former Eintracht Frankfurt star Hugo Ekitike moved to Liverpool in the summer after a solid campaign in the Bundesliga, where he scored 15 goals in 33 games for the German outfit in the league, tempting Arne Slot to make a move for his services.Although Liverpool’s signing of Alexander Isak from Newcastle grabbed the headlines, that wasn’t until later in the window and Ekitike pounced upon that chance for minutes by scoring three goals in his opening five Premier League clashes.That’s enough to rank him joint-eighth in the top goalscorer standings in the top-flight. But Liverpool star Ekitike has named the man who sits comfortably top of those rankings in Erling Haaland as the best finisher in the league.Photo by Matt McNulty/Getty ImagesHugo Ekitike makes Erling Haaland admission as the best talisman in EnglandThis season alone, there is no doubting that Erling Haaland is the best striker in the Premier League, with Peter Crouch labelling Haaland as better than Alexander Isak.11 goals is almost double the next best goalscorer in Bournemouth’s Antoine Semenyo, whilst he also has three goals in two Champions League games, and an incredible nine Norway goals in just three matches for his home nation since September’s international break.It’s the best start he’s made to any campaign and that has seen Hugo Ekitike admit that he wants to emulate the 25-year-old when it comes to tucking chances away.Pressed to name the best finishers in the Premier League, Ekitike said with a smile on ESPN: “Me…”, before adding: “I think it’s [Erling] Haaland.“Haaland is clinical.



Obviously like his aggressiveness, but also the calm he has in front of the goal.“I’m really looking to be like him. He’s a very top, top striker.”Haaland is just four goals from making the Premier League’s ‘100 Club’, an outstanding feat inside just 105 games.Photo by Michael Regan – The FA/The FA via Getty ImagesErling Haaland can break incredible Premier League record by 2030Former Borussia Dortmund star Erling Haaland joined Manchester City in 2022, and has since produced form averaging a goal every 1.09 matches over his three-and-a-quarter seasons in the top-flight.If he keeps up that rate of scoring, it will take him just 285 games to beat Alan Shearer’s all-time Premier League record.Given he’s already played 105 matches, that means Haaland would only need another 180 outings to match that record.PlayerPremier League matchesPremier League goalsGoals per gameAlan Shearer4412600.58Erling Haaland105960.91The same rate of goals over five seasons of consistent matches would be enough for him to break that record.Effectively, we could see Haaland break the Premier League record as early as winter 2030 if he continues to flourish without injuries at Manchester City.Fans will be hoping he doesn’t move as the long-standing record threatens to be beaten by the 6ft 5in star.
